Comprehending the Dodge Ram Fuel System
The fuel system in a Dodge Ram is intricate and includes several crucial parts, each playing a crucial role in ensuring that the engine receives the ideal quantity of fuel at the right time. Here's a breakdown of the important fuel parts and their functions:
Fuel PartFunctionFuel PumpProvides fuel from the tank to the engine.Fuel FilterRemoves pollutants and impurities from the fuel before it reaches the engine.Fuel InjectorsSprays fuel into the engine's combustion chamber for appropriate combustion.Fuel LinesTransportation fuel between the fuel tank, pump, filter, and injectors.Fuel Pressure RegulatorPreserves a consistent fuel pressure throughout the system.Fuel TankShops the fuel used by the engine.
Each of these components works in harmony to ensure ideal performance. Failure in any among them can result in poor engine efficiency, decreased fuel performance, and even engine damage.

1. Regularly Replace the Fuel Filter
The fuel filter need to be replaced according to the manufacturer's suggestions. An excellent general rule is to alter it every 30,000 miles. A tidy fuel filter ensures that your engine gets tidy fuel and performs optimally.
2. Screen Fuel Pump Performance
Keep an ear out for uncommon sounds from the fuel pump, such as whining or grinding noises. If the pump is loud, it may be time for a replacement. In addition, take notice of your automobile's acceleration and fuel effectiveness; changes may indicate an issue with the fuel pump.
3. Inspect Fuel Lines for Damage
Routinely check fuel lines for any indications of wear or leakages. Try to find fractures, deterioration, or loose connections, and deal with any problems without delay to avoid fuel leaks.
4. Keep the Fuel System Clean
Utilizing top quality fuel and periodically adding a fuel system cleaner can assist keep the injectors and fuel lines clean. This helps in ensuring the longevity of the fuel system elements.
5. Conduct Fuel Pressure Tests
If you suspect a breakdown in the fuel system, performing a fuel pressure test can assist diagnose issues. A mechanic can easily perform this test to assess whether the fuel pressure is within the recommended variety.
